The Rise of BNPL in E-commerce and Retail
The integration of Buy Now Pay Later (BNPL) solutions within the e-commerce and retail sectors has significantly transformed the shopping experience for consumers. Retailers are increasingly adopting these payment options, making it easier for customers to afford products without immediate financial strain. This trend is particularly evident during major shopping events where consumers often feel pressured to stick to budgets while still wanting to enjoy the latest offerings. BNPL allows them to purchase desired items and spread payments over time, enhancing overall customer satisfaction and loyalty. Retailers benefit from increased cart sizes and reduced cart abandonment rates, as shoppers are more likely to complete purchases when flexible payment options are available. Additionally, with many providers offering a seamless integration into existing platforms, businesses can implement BNPL without significant operational disruptions, making it an appealing choice for modern retailers.
Consumer Benefits of BNPL Options
One of the primary advantages of Buy Now Pay Later schemes is the flexibility they offer consumers in managing their finances. With the ability to break down larger purchases into smaller, manageable installments, consumers can budget more effectively, aligning their payment schedules with their income cycles. This flexibility is particularly beneficial in times of economic uncertainty, where unexpected expenses can arise. Furthermore, many BNPL providers do not require a hard credit check, allowing individuals with limited credit histories to access financing options that would otherwise be unavailable to them. This inclusivity fosters a sense of financial empowerment, enabling consumers to make purchases that improve their quality of life without the burden of high-interest rates or hidden fees that characterize traditional credit options. Overall, BNPL is reshaping consumer behavior by providing more accessible pathways to financial management.
Potential Drawbacks and Considerations
Despite the numerous benefits associated with Buy Now Pay Later offerings, there are potential drawbacks that consumers should consider. One significant concern is the risk of overspending; with the allure of deferred payments, individuals may be tempted to purchase items beyond their financial means. This can lead to accumulating debt if payments are not managed carefully. Additionally, some BNPL providers might charge late fees or interest on missed payments, which can quickly negate the initial benefit of interest-free financing. It is crucial for consumers to fully understand the terms and conditions associated with each BNPL plan, ensuring they remain within their budgets and avoid falling into financial pitfalls. Education on responsible spending and the implications of BNPL is vital, especially as its popularity continues to grow and more consumers turn to these services for their financial needs.
The Role of Technology in BNPL Expansion
The proliferation of technology has played a pivotal role in the growth and adoption of Buy Now Pay Later solutions across various sectors. Innovative fintech companies are leveraging data analytics and artificial intelligence to assess consumer creditworthiness quickly and accurately, allowing for more personalized financing options. This technological advancement not only streamlines the application process but also enhances the user experience by providing instant approvals and transparent payment plans. Furthermore, the integration of BNPL features within mobile applications and online platforms makes it easier than ever for consumers to access these services at their convenience. As technology continues to evolve, the landscape of BNPL will likely expand, offering even more tailored solutions and conveniences for both consumers and businesses, thus solidifying its place in the future of finance.

Future Trends in BNPL Services
Looking ahead, the future of Buy Now Pay Later services appears bright and full of potential for further innovation and growth. As consumer adoption increases, we can anticipate more diverse offerings tailored to specific industries, such as travel, healthcare, and education. Companies may begin to partner with traditional financial institutions to enhance trust and provide additional safeguards for consumers. We are also likely to see the introduction of subscription-based BNPL models, where consumers can manage recurring payments for services like streaming or fitness memberships. Furthermore, regulatory scrutiny on BNPL practices is expected to increase, prompting providers to adopt more transparent practices to ensure consumer protection. This evolving landscape will require consumers to stay informed and adapt to new developments, ensuring they can make the most of the financial opportunities presented by BNPL while navigating its complexities.
